// examples/validation_1.rs
//! Demonstrates field validation with the canvas library
//!
//! This example REQUIRES the `validation` and `cursor-style` features to compile.
//!
//! Run with:
//! cargo run --example validation_1 --features "gui,validation"
//!
//! This will fail without validation:
//! cargo run --example validation_1 --features "gui"

// REQUIRE validation feature - example won't compile without it
#[cfg(not(all(feature = "validation", feature = "cursor-style")))]
compile_error!(
    "This example requires the 'validation' and 'cursor-style' features. \
     Run with: cargo run --example validation_1 --features \"gui,validation,cursor-style\""
);

use crossterm::{
    event::{self, DisableMouseCapture, EnableMouseCapture, Event, KeyCode, KeyModifiers},
    execute,
    terminal::{EnterAlternateScreen, LeaveAlternateScreen, disable_raw_mode, enable_raw_mode},
};
use ratatui::{
    Frame, Terminal,
    backend::{Backend, CrosstermBackend},
    layout::{Constraint, Direction, Layout, Rect},
    style::{Color, Style},
    text::{Line, Span},
    widgets::{Block, Borders, Paragraph, Wrap},
};
use std::io;
use tui_canvas::{
    AppMode, CharacterLimits, CursorManager, DataProvider, TextFormState, ValidationConfig,
    ValidationConfigBuilder, ValidationResult, render_canvas_default,
};

// Import CountMode from the validation module directly
use tui_canvas::validation::limits::CountMode;

// Demo form data with different validation rules
struct ValidationDemoData {
    fields: Vec<(String, String)>,
}

impl ValidationDemoData {
    fn new() -> Self {
        Self {
            fields: vec![
                ("👤 Name (max 20)".to_string(), "".to_string()),
                ("📧 Email (max 50, warn@40)".to_string(), "".to_string()),
                ("🔑 Password (5-20 chars)".to_string(), "".to_string()),
                ("🔢 ID (min 3, max 10)".to_string(), "".to_string()),
                ("📝 Comment (min 10, max 100)".to_string(), "".to_string()),
                ("🏷️  Tag (max 30, bytes)".to_string(), "".to_string()),
                ("🌍 Unicode (width, min 2)".to_string(), "".to_string()),
            ],
        }
    }
}

impl DataProvider for ValidationDemoData {
    fn field_count(&self) -> usize {
        self.fields.len()
    }

    fn field_name(&self, index: usize) -> &str {
        &self.fields[index].0
    }

    fn field_value(&self, index: usize) -> &str {
        &self.fields[index].1
    }

    fn set_field_value(&mut self, index: usize, value: String) {
        self.fields[index].1 = value;
    }

    fn supports_suggestions(&self, _field_index: usize) -> bool {
        false
    }

    fn display_value(&self, _index: usize) -> Option<&str> {
        None
    }

    // Validation configuration per field
    fn validation_config(&self, field_index: usize) -> Option<ValidationConfig> {
        match field_index {
            0 => Some(ValidationConfig::with_max_length(20)), // Name: simple 20 char limit
            1 => Some(
                ValidationConfigBuilder::new()
                    .with_character_limits(CharacterLimits::new(50).with_warning_threshold(40))
                    .build(),
            ), // Email: 50 chars with warning at 40
            2 => Some(
                ValidationConfigBuilder::new()
                    .with_character_limits(CharacterLimits::new_range(5, 20))
                    .build(),
            ), // Password: must be 5-20 characters (blocks field switching if 1-4 chars)
            3 => Some(
                ValidationConfigBuilder::new()
                    .with_character_limits(CharacterLimits::new_range(3, 10))
                    .build(),
            ), // ID: must be 3-10 characters (blocks field switching if 1-2 chars)
            4 => Some(
                ValidationConfigBuilder::new()
                    .with_character_limits(CharacterLimits::new_range(10, 100))
                    .build(),
            ), // Comment: must be 10-100 characters (blocks field switching if 1-9 chars)
            5 => Some(
                ValidationConfigBuilder::new()
                    .with_character_limits(
                        CharacterLimits::new(30).with_count_mode(CountMode::Bytes),
                    )
                    .build(),
            ), // Tag: 30 bytes (useful for UTF-8)
            6 => Some(
                ValidationConfigBuilder::new()
                    .with_character_limits(
                        CharacterLimits::new_range(2, 20).with_count_mode(CountMode::DisplayWidth),
                    )
                    .build(),
            ), // Unicode: 2-20 display width (useful for CJK characters, blocks if 1 char)
            _ => None,
        }
    }
}
